What does a great financial advisor actually do when life gets messy?In this episode, we talk about the real side of financial planning: meeting people in every season of life and helping them move from overwhelmed to clear, confident, and hopeful. From inheritances and business sales to retirement decisions and unexpected illness, we break down why “math only” is not enough, and how a personalized plan built around your story changes everything.If you have been putting off planning because you feel like it is “too late” or “not the right time,” this conversation is for you.
